8.9 Richard Thomas PHILLIPS ( Richard James (1) PHILLIPS , William (3) PHILLIPS , William (2) PHILLIPS , William (1) PHILLIPS , Thomas (2) PHILP , Thomas (1) , Jacob (1) ) was born on 28 Jun 1860 in Brixham and died on 5 Dec 1916.
Richard was a Brixham fisherman. In the 1881 census, he was recorded as a mate on board the Presto moored in Madron Harbour, Penzance. (His father was the master, and his brothers Edmund and James were also in the crew.) Richard gained his Certificate of Competency as "skipper of a vessel employed in fishing only" after an examination held in Brixham on 8 Jan 1884, at which time he was living at Beach Square. He was the owner of Camellia (1902-1917) and its skippers from 1889 to 1893. Before his marriage, he was living at Furzes Alley, Brixham, with his parents.

8.10 Martha Frances PHILLIPS ( Richard James (1) PHILLIPS , William (3) PHILLIPS , William (2) PHILLIPS , William (1) PHILLIPS , Thomas (2) PHILP , Thomas (1) , Jacob (1) ) was born on 9 May 1862 in Hull and died on 22 Mar 1927 in Brixham.
Martha was born during one her father's several moves to Hull. She finally returned to Brixham with her parents in about 1865, and at the age of 19 was a domestic servant working for William Cove (baker and confectioner) at 28 Fore Street. In 1888, she was a witness at the marriage of her brother Edmund (the other witness being her future husband) and in 1891 was recorded as a housekeeper in her parents' home in Furzes Alley. A gravestone in Brixham churchyard commemorates her, her husband and their daughter Hettie.
![]()
Martha married Samuel (1) HOLLAND, son of Brixham mariner William HOLLAND and Mary Ann née BEALE, on 4 Jul 1891 in Brixham. Samuel was born on 30 Jul 1861 and died on 9 May 1944 in Brixham.
Samuel was another Brixham fisherman. At the time of the 1881 census, Sam was an A B Seaman on the vessel Presto moored in Madron Harbour, Penzance. (His future father-in-law and three future brothers-in-law were also in the crew.) In 1891, he was recorded as a trawler owner living with his mother at 1 Hollands Court, and in 1901 he was a fishing smack owner. In fact, he was owner and skipper of Guess (1889-1920) and owner of Guess Again (1916-1922) until he sold it to his brother-in-law Arthur. Samuel's address while he was owner of Guess was Greens Court, Higher St. then 83 New Road, and his address as owner of Guess Again was 3 New Road.
Oral history has it that Sam used to annoy harbourmasters when they asked him the name of his boat by replying "Guess!". After they had got used to that little joke, they had to put up with the answer "Guess again!".

8.11 Edmund Albert PHILLIPS ( Richard James (1) PHILLIPS , William (3) PHILLIPS , William (2) PHILLIPS , William (1) PHILLIPS , Thomas (2) PHILP , Thomas (1) , Jacob (1) ) was born on 24 Jul 1865 in Brixham and died on 3 Mar 1939.
Edmund was another Brixham fisherman. In the 1881 census, he was recorded as a deck boy on the Presto moored in Madron Harbour, Penzance. (His father and his brothers Richard and James were also in the crew.) Later, he skippered Geina (1892-1918), Camellia (1895-1920) and Arghiro (1901-1924). He also owned Camellia for 4 months in 1917, having bought it from his brother Richard.
In 1891 Edmund was living at 12 St. Peters Hill and was still also living in Brixham in 1901. He owned 53 Berry Head Road and lived there from at least 1915 until he died.
Edmund married (1) Eliza Lateman NICHOLAS, daughter of a shipwright, on 5 Aug 1888 in Newlyn by Penzance, Cornwall. Eliza was born in 1865 in Penzance and christened there on 1 Apr 1865. She died in 1915 or 1916.

William started his adult life as a fisherman, but then joined the Royal Navy on his 18th birthday. He saw service in a large number of ships, including HMS Cambridge and HMS Defiance and was promoted to Petty Officer in 1890. William was shore pensioned on his 38th birthday and joined the Royal Fleet Reserve. He was called back into active service when World War I broke out and served as Chief Petty Officer until 11 Sep 1919.
